mirror of
				https://github.com/immich-app/immich.git
				synced 2025-10-30 10:12:33 -04:00 
			
		
		
		
	
		
			
				
	
	
		
			19 lines
		
	
	
		
			462 B
		
	
	
	
		
			Docker
		
	
	
	
	
	
			
		
		
	
	
			19 lines
		
	
	
		
			462 B
		
	
	
	
		
			Docker
		
	
	
	
	
	
| FROM node:20-alpine3.19@sha256:291e84d956f1aff38454bbd3da38941461ad569a185c20aa289f71f37ea08e23 as core
 | |
| 
 | |
| WORKDIR /usr/src/open-api/typescript-sdk
 | |
| COPY open-api/typescript-sdk/package*.json open-api/typescript-sdk/tsconfig*.json ./
 | |
| RUN npm ci
 | |
| COPY open-api/typescript-sdk/ ./
 | |
| RUN npm run build
 | |
| 
 | |
| WORKDIR /usr/src/app
 | |
| 
 | |
| COPY cli/package.json cli/package-lock.json ./
 | |
| RUN npm ci
 | |
| 
 | |
| COPY cli .
 | |
| RUN npm run build
 | |
| 
 | |
| WORKDIR /import
 | |
| 
 | |
| ENTRYPOINT ["node", "/usr/src/app/dist"] |